Description
Join the effort to remove invasive plants, plant new native plants, and generally clean up and beautify the Copeland Creek and Native Plant Garden.

About the Center
Sonoma State University’s Center for Environmental Inquiry empowers university students to work with community members on the environmental challenges of the North Bay. Our mission is to create an engaged and environmentally ready society, one where all people have the skills to find solutions to the challenges facing our earth. SSU Preserves are open to everyone engaged in education or research. Reservations are required.
